Juice Up is a popular juice and beverage shop in the Shanir Akhra area, primarily catering to youth and students from several nearby schools, colleges, and universities. This small shop has created a cozy haven amidst the hustle and bustle of the busy city. Every day, countless people come here to enjoy cold and refreshing drinks. The juice shop is located next to Bornamala School and College. Juice is sold at the shop every day from 11.00 am to 11.59 pm. The biggest attraction of Juice Up is its variety of juices and shakes. Here, you can find seasonal fruit juices, including mango, malta, pineapple, watermelon, and papaya. Each juice is made with fresh fruit, which is very tasty and healthy. Apart from that, their milkshake and smoothie items are also quite popular. Chocolate shake, Oreo shake, and mango smoothie are especially popular. Juices are made with fresh fruits indigenous to our country. I ordered Malta juice after looking at the menu.
I tried a Malta juice and a mango smoothie. The Malta juice was very fresh and had a sweet-sour taste, which was very refreshing on a hot day. On the other hand, the mango smoothie was thick and sweet, which I really liked. The drinks are served in beautiful glasses or cups, as beautiful to look at as they are to use. After ordering the juice, you have to wait a while. There are advertisements on the shop's walls featuring pictures of different fruit juices. Each juice is accompanied by its name and price.
In terms of price, Juice Up is also quite affordable compared to other juice shops. Compared to other big-brand juice shops, good-quality drinks are available here at a lower price. Usually, the price of a juice is between 80 and 150 taka, and a shake or smoothie is available between 150 and 250 taka. Such fresh and delicious drinks are very rare at this price. The amount of ice and sugar in the juice is adjusted according to customer needs. The shop's salesmen are very sincere with customers.
